Re: [exim] Help to logical OR two conditions

2020-10-01 Thread Phil Pennock via Exim-users
On 2020-10-01 at 13:24 +0700, Victor Sudakov via Exim-users wrote: > Could you please help me unite the following two ACL expressions into one: > > accept condition = > ${lookup{$local_part@$domain}lsearch{/etc/dovecot/aliases}{yes}} > accept condition = >

Re: [exim] SMTP timeout after pipelined end of data (5334 bytes written), hang at DAT 7247 LAST. Local_scan vs chunking issue?

2020-10-01 Thread Heiko Schlittermann via Exim-users
Jeremy Harris via Exim-users (Fr 11 Sep 2020 18:15:28 CEST): > >> Marc MERLIN via Exim-users (Do 10 Sep 2020 21:24:51 > >> CEST): > >>> Howdy, > >>> I have Exim version 4.92 #3 built 07-May-2019 17:44:23 > > Note that Buster, at least, is showing 4.92-8+deb10u4 My git repo on exim.org:

Re: [exim] Help to logical OR two conditions

2020-10-01 Thread Jeremy Harris via Exim-users
On 01/10/2020 12:45, Victor Sudakov via Exim-users wrote: > accept condition = > ${lookup{$local_part@$domain}lsearch{/etc/dovecot/aliases}{yes}} > > Doesn't this line mean that the right part of the expression is err... hmm... > a condition? No. The ACL general-purpose condition called

Re: [exim] Help to logical OR two conditions

2020-10-01 Thread Cyborg via Exim-users
Am 01.10.20 um 11:00 schrieb Victor Sudakov via Exim-users: > Cyborg via Exim-users wrote: accept  condition  = ${if or{\    { and{ {CONDITION 1}{CONDITION 2} }}\    { CONDITION 3 }\   } {1}}

Re: [exim] Help to logical OR two conditions

2020-10-01 Thread Victor Sudakov via Exim-users
Evgeniy Berdnikov via Exim-users wrote: > On Thu, Oct 01, 2020 at 05:21:38PM +0700, Victor Sudakov via Exim-users wrote: > > Jeremy Harris via Exim-users wrote: > > > On 01/10/2020 10:00, Victor Sudakov via Exim-users wrote: > > > > And I'm damned if I understand what is "condition name expected."

Re: [exim] Help to logical OR two conditions

2020-10-01 Thread Evgeniy Berdnikov via Exim-users
On Thu, Oct 01, 2020 at 05:21:38PM +0700, Victor Sudakov via Exim-users wrote: > Jeremy Harris via Exim-users wrote: > > On 01/10/2020 10:00, Victor Sudakov via Exim-users wrote: > > > And I'm damned if I understand what is "condition name expected." > > > >

Re: [exim] Help to logical OR two conditions

2020-10-01 Thread Victor Sudakov via Exim-users
Jeremy Harris via Exim-users wrote: > On 01/10/2020 10:00, Victor Sudakov via Exim-users wrote: > > And I'm damned if I understand what is "condition name expected." > > http://exim.org/exim-html-current/doc/html/spec_html/ch-string_expansions.html > > Section 7, "Expansion conditions". I've

Re: [exim] Help to logical OR two conditions

2020-10-01 Thread Jeremy Harris via Exim-users
On 01/10/2020 10:00, Victor Sudakov via Exim-users wrote: > And I'm damned if I understand what is "condition name expected." http://exim.org/exim-html-current/doc/html/spec_html/ch-string_expansions.html Section 7, "Expansion conditions". -- Cheers, Jeremy -- ## List details at

Re: [exim] Help to logical OR two conditions

2020-10-01 Thread Victor Sudakov via Exim-users
Cyborg via Exim-users wrote: > > > >> accept  condition  = ${if or{\ > >>    { and{ {CONDITION 1}{CONDITION 2} }}\ > >>    { CONDITION 3 }\ > >>   } {1}} > > So, for my case it should look like this, right )(copied

Re: [exim] Help to logical OR two conditions

2020-10-01 Thread Cyborg via Exim-users
Am 01.10.20 um 09:59 schrieb Victor Sudakov via Exim-users: > >> accept  condition  = ${if or{\ >>    { and{ {CONDITION 1}{CONDITION 2} }}\ >>    { CONDITION 3 }\ >>   } {1}} > So, for my case it should look like

Re: [exim] Help to logical OR two conditions

2020-10-01 Thread Victor Sudakov via Exim-users
Cyborg via Exim-users wrote: > Am 01.10.20 um 08:24 schrieb Victor Sudakov via Exim-users: > > Dear Colleagues, > > > > Could you please help me unite the following two ACL expressions into one: > > > > accept condition = > > ${lookup{$local_part@$domain}lsearch{/etc/dovecot/aliases}{yes}} >

Re: [exim] Help to logical OR two conditions

2020-10-01 Thread Cyborg via Exim-users
Am 01.10.20 um 08:24 schrieb Victor Sudakov via Exim-users: > Dear Colleagues, > > Could you please help me unite the following two ACL expressions into one: > > accept condition = > ${lookup{$local_part@$domain}lsearch{/etc/dovecot/aliases}{yes}} > accept condition = >

[exim] Exim 4.94: address suffixes and local delivery to subdirectories in maildir mailboxes

2020-10-01 Thread ivanov via Exim-users
Hello! I try to use Exim 4.94 as my post server and I want to use address suffixes and local delivery to subdirectories in maildir mailboxes. I've used this decision from the official documentation (ch. 26.5): directory = /var/mail/$local_part_data\ ${if eq{$local_part_suffix}{}{}\

[exim] Help to logical OR two conditions

2020-10-01 Thread Victor Sudakov via Exim-users
Dear Colleagues, Could you please help me unite the following two ACL expressions into one: accept condition = ${lookup{$local_part@$domain}lsearch{/etc/dovecot/aliases}{yes}} accept condition = ${lookup{$local_part@$domain}lsearch{/etc/dovecot/users}{yes}} Should be fairly simple